The Lion Electric Co. Launches All-Electric Class 8 Urban Truck
The Lion Electric Co. (Lion) unveiled its first all-electric Class 8 urban truck on March 11th 2019. The Lion8 will be commercialized this Fall and the first vehicle will be delivered to Société des Alcools du Québec (SAQ).
